Strategic Plan
The strategic plan was created in December
2002 at a meeting in Phoenix with
representatives from each criterion group.
At the last meeting in Jackson, goal groups
formed and recommended changes to the
plan. Participants requested that the
subsequent draft be passed through the
Delphi process.
Delphi 19 & 20
Most revisions in each round were
incorporated either in the text or by
comments in the plan (see handout).
Some objectives were moved to
different goals to better define the work
of each goal group and to reduce
overlap.

Themes (cont.)
Prioritization: Participants agreed that the
C&I needed to be prioritized first and then the
data gaps and research questions could be
pursued.



Goal 1, Obj. 2: prioritize indicators into “core” and
“non-core”
Goal 1, Obj. 2, product: list indicators that have
high priority regardless of data availability
Goal 4: research should begin with the “core”
indicators and develop “non-core” at a later time.
Identifying research needs
Goal 1, obj. 2, tactic 4: identify data
gaps that need more research and
provide to research goal group.
Goal 4, Obj. 2, tactic 1: identify and
publicize a prioritized list of needed
research.
